WebMay 7, 2024 · Under normal circumstances a teacher, tutor or senior member of centre staff who teaches the subject being examined must not be an invigilator for an examination in that subject. For the June 2024 series only, where no other suitable invigilators are available, subject teachers may invigilate an examination in their own subject. binns road liverpool postcode

WebSep 25, 2024 · It is good practice for centres to notify awarding organisations when there is the possibility of course tutors also acting as test invigilators. Doing so means that awarding organisations can take... WebThe art and design teacher can invigilate the art exam. However, if they are required to give extensive technical support during the exam then an additional invigilator should be …
